Edit by 3-5 I meant days Last edited: Oct 22, 2016 C Chinnyman Wearing official robes Joined Oct 6, 2016 WebNov 15, 2007 · Firstly, the vehicle you want to take the plate off must be taxed and have a current MOT and it’s got to be available for inspection by the DVLA. It may be possible to get a plate off an untaxed car that does not have an MOT, but it will be subject to certain conditions that the DVLA might apply and its not a given that it will be granted.

There are few … simplicity 2830WebMar 24, 2024 · To retain your private number plate, you must apply to the DVLA to take the private plate off your vehicle. If successful, you will be sent a V778 retention document, which will give you the right to assign your private number plate to another vehicle within the next 10 years.
